Belgrade to get new Nikola Tesla museum – Investor to be be known in 2017?

Belgrade will get a new Nikola Tesla museum, and the Government of Serbia announces that the investor for the project will be known by the end of 2017.

The museum will contain accompanying features as well – a center for promotion of science, talented young people, IT and genetic engineering.

This May, the Government of Serbia founded a coordination authority for monitoring the construction of the new Nikola Tesla museum and the accompanying features, the head of which is Minister of Construction Zorana Mihajlovic.

The Ministry of Construction says for eKapija that the next session of the coordination authority is scheduled for August 3, 2017.

– All the necessary documentation is currently being reviewed and everything important is being summed up, so that the decision on how to carry out the project in the most efficient manner would be reached at the next session of the coordination authority. The aim is for the project to run smoothly and be realized in as short amount of time as possible – the Ministry of Construction explained.

At the previous session, Mihajlovic talked to the members of the authority about the details of the project and all the questions regarding the procedures, the necessary documentation and the dynamics of the realization.

Mihajlovic pointed out the importance of the construction of the Nikola Tesla museum for Serbia at the session and emphasized that the task of the coordination authority was to support and monitor the project in detail so that the realization would be as efficient as possible.


– Our first goal is to choose the investor by the end of the year – she said and added that the Ministry of Construction, Transport and Infrastructure would provide all the professional support needed for the realization of the project.

Aside from Mihajlovic, the coordination authority features Minister of Culture and Information Vladan Vukosavljevic, as deputy president, whereas other members are Minister of Education, Science and Technological Development Mladen Sarcevic, Minister of Agriculture and Environmental Protection Branislav Nedimovic, City Manager Goran Vesic, City Architect Milutin Folic, head of the Property Office of the Republic of Serbia, Jovan Vorkapic, acting director of the Republic Geodetic Authority, Borko Draskovic, state secretaries and deputy ministers.
